ZEN was still around $6 a few days ago, but has now already moved back above $7.

What I’m looking at here isn’t that $ZEN suddenly had some major news on its own; rather, $ZEC has already demonstrated the capital strength of the entire privacy track.

Over two days, ZEC pulled from around 1100 to 1500, and during the same period, ZEN also returned from the $6 range to above $7.

The biggest difference between the two is size.

ZEC is already in the stage where institutional capital can be continuously allocated. ZEN’s market cap is far smaller than ZEC’s, and its maximum supply is only 21 million coins. As long as this wave of funding in the privacy track doesn’t quickly fade, ZEN’s price elasticity will be much higher than ZEC’s.
